ubecoffee

Proving you're disabled generally requires disclosing private medical info so that gets pretty sketchy. A lot of disabilities also don't have specific diagnoses which leaves a lot of disabled people out of accessing supports, or the diagnostic process is long and expensive. Disabled is also not really a term that doctors or therapists or anyone give you. You kind of have to come into that identity in your own. I saw a doctor who insisted I wasn't disabled, I just wasn't able to do xyz (aka disabled). I use a mobility device and still had to fight to get my application for a parking permit filled out. Sorry to info-dump! This is all just me explaining that proving disability is a confusing, not great way to offer accommodations. I would personally rather one or two people get access to things they don't need than have someone who needs it shut out from it because of red tape. Scalpers on the other hand... more needs to be done about them.

Just saying, as a person with multiple disabilities, I get really tired of able bodied people acting like this is a bad thing. Places trying to go rogue either benevolently or molevolently are a nightmare. Hotels and other services you cannot freely access can effectively render them unusable. Just for us to travel to a city or go to a show, it can take my wife hours of phone calls sometimes to show up and have them search for hours literally doing things like walking into each empty hotel room on their breaks calling you because they don't know which are the accessible rooms because they are not in the computer. Additionally, many disabilities can take upwards of a decade to diagnose, especially those that effect the nervous system. Places handing your medical information to some manager with a high school education to decide if you get to bring your wheelchair into a park or your service dog into a hotel or your workplace effectively locks you out of public life. These are not quick calls or processes, often these barriers can take my wife 5-10 hours of work to navigate. That adds up easily and quickly. Scalpers suck, but they suck because scalping is awful. The solution is laws that prevent reselling rickets and reservations higher than the ticket price, not to create more barriers to access for people with disabilities. We honestly have enough trouble navigating the barriers that are there already.

sevendaysky

I went to a play recently and as I sat down, I looked around and asked myself where they put the wheelchair accessible seating. I had to look when I got home. It didn't surprise me to discover that the seats were on the extreme left and right sides, far back under the overhang. They did have some labeled "aisle transfer seat" (moveable arm) on the aisles, but I have to wonder how someone attending alone would move the wheelchair or walker out of the aisle during the show. An usher would have to stand by to take the chair and deliver it during intermission and when the show's over. You'd get stuck there for quite a while until someone could get through the crowd to reach you with your equipment... and the aisles didn't strike me as quite wide enough for a wheelchair to safely turn around. There seems to be passages on the sides that have a gentler slope and sort of angle back and around, but that means you'd have to go DOWN the aisle against traffic and... yeah. A theater I work with periodically recently renovated their seating to include several flat decks with railings - one in the front row, two in the back row, and two more halfway down, on the aisles. If no one using a wheelchair or walker uses those spaces, they go in shortly before the show starts and put down some comfy freestanding chairs, and anyone in the lobby on the backup list can sit there. If it's all freestanding chairs, I think it's twelve seats or so if you squeeze in. Their next-steps document talks about updating the back of house to be more accessible for disabled performers which is SERIOUSLY needed. There's an external access door to the backstage area, but you end up stepping down or up to reach the auditorium or the stage. The dressing rooms are both down two or three steps although the single-bathroom/dressing rooms on each side are on-level with the stage itself. It's a challenge because it's an older building and I can't remember now if they own it outright or are leasing so there's a lot of hoops to jump through, a lot of construction and permits and stuff. Even the big-name theaters can find it hard to renovate to make the necessary accommodations in buildings that have been in use for a long time. New-built ones are usually a bit more conscious of these needs.

This is an ethical question that comes on on cruise ships constantly. Carnival for instance has loads of disabled cabins in that are noted as such but you can freely book them as they don't ask for any kind of proof of disability. They generally are the last ones booked for reasons. On a cruise ship it essentially means the cabin has a roll in shower and an emergency pull cord near the bed. The line can move you if a disabled passenger needs a cabin. I hate seeing shows with rows of unused disabled seating, the venue should be able to sell them to others with the understanding they might be relocated if necessary. That's how it's supposed to work.
